WebThe elegy started out, in modern times, as a term for a specific type of couplet but grew into a form based on genre - sorrowful, contemplating and mourning over death in general or over a specific person's death. A quatrain is a four-line stanza. Heroic quatrains rhyme in an abab pattern and are written in iambic pentameter.
